Monthly figures for one person. Rent, meals and coworking are measured values, not shares of the total budget.
| Expense | Budapest | Rio de Janeiro |
|---|---|---|
| Comfortable budgetper month, all in | $1,500✓ | $1,600 |
| Rent, 1BR city centre | $750 | $700✓ |
| Meal, mid-range | $11✓ | $20 |
| Coworking deskper month | $220 | $150✓ |
| Cost of living indexlower is cheaper | 49.7 | 46.0✓ |

Choose Budapest if runs $100/mo cheaper, internet is faster at 200 Mbps, it scores higher on safety (80 vs 45) and it is more walkable.
Choose Rio de Janeiro if rent is $50/mo lower, the climate scores better and the headline tax rate is lower.
